
Mysterious apology dream: what does it mean?
A mysterious apology dream shifts the meaning from a clear, resolved regret to something unnamed. You sense sorry being offered, but the source or reason stays hidden, pointing to feelings you haven't fully identified yet.

In a plain apology dream, you usually know who is speaking and roughly why. Here, that clarity disappears. A voice, a shadow, or an unseen presence says sorry, and the not-knowing is the whole point. Your mind may be signaling that guilt or hurt exists somewhere in your life, but you haven't pinned down its shape yet.
This often shows up during periods of vague unease, when something feels off but you can't name it. The dream isn't hiding information to unsettle you. It's more like your inner world nudging you to pay attention, even before your conscious mind has sorted out the details.
This dream can mean your mind is finally starting to process an old hurt you buried without realizing it. Even without clear answers, the fact that something is reaching out to make amends suggests healing is quietly underway, even before you consciously understand what needs forgiving.
Sometimes this dream reflects lingering unease about a situation you've avoided examining closely. If the apology feels cold or unsettling rather than sincere, it may be worth gently asking yourself what relationship or decision has been sitting unresolved in the back of your mind.

Frequently asked questions
›What does it mean when someone apologizes in a dream but you can't see their face?
This usually means the guilt or hurt feels real but unidentified. Your mind may be processing a situation involving someone you haven't consciously connected to that feeling yet, or a part of yourself you're not ready to fully look at.
›Why do I feel someone is sorry in a dream with no explanation given?
Dreams often skip explanations because emotions surface before logic does. Feeling sorry-ness without context suggests your subconscious is flagging an unresolved issue before your waking mind has organized the details around it.
›Is a mysterious apology dream a warning?
It's less a warning and more an invitation to notice something you've overlooked. Think of it as a gentle nudge toward self-reflection rather than a sign that anything bad is about to happen.
